In 2023, Shunkhlai Holding centralized its security operations by deploying Splunk UBA alongside Splunk Enterprise and Splunk Enterprise Security under the Analytics and BI category. The initiative consolidated SOC visibility and standardized detection and response workflows across the company’s Mongolian businesses within the manufacturing group, using Splunk as the vendor platform for behavior driven detections. Splunk UBA was implemented to provide user behavior analytics, anomaly detection, risk scoring, and behavior-analytics driven detections that augment SIEM alerts and support investigator workflows. Configuration focused on behavioral baselining, enrichment of event context, and automated evidence capture to prioritize alerts and accelerate triage and investigation. Architecturally, the deployment centralized telemetry ingestion into Splunk Enterprise with detection and investigative layers executed in Splunk Enterprise Security and Splunk UBA, integrated across security monitoring feeds, endpoint telemetry, and network data sources. Unity acted as the system integrator for rollout, handling configuration, deployment coordination, and operational handover to the centralized SOC. Governance and process changes standardized incident response playbooks and centralized alert routing into the SOC, embedding behavior-analytics driven detections into escalation and investigation procedures. According to Splunk’s case study, the implementation produced enhanced threat detection driven by user behavior analytics, two to three times faster incident response and a 50 percent reduction in downtime.

Shunkhlai Holding is a Manufacturing organization based in Mongolia, with around 7500 employees and annual revenues of $850.0 million.

Shunkhlai Holding operates a diverse technology stack with applications such as Splunk UBA, Microsoft 365 and Microsoft Azure Cloud Services, covering areas like Analytics and BI, Collaboration and Application Hosting and Computing Services.

Shunkhlai Holding has invested in cloud applications and AI-driven platforms to optimize efficiency and growth, collaborating with vendors such as Splunk and Microsoft.

Shunkhlai Holding recently adopted applications including Splunk UBA in 2023, Microsoft 365 in 2023 and Microsoft Azure Cloud Services in 2023, highlighting its ongoing modernization strategy.
